Prof. Marc Abadie
Professor Emeritus, University of Montpellier, Institute Charles Gerhardt Montpellier - Aggregates, Interfaces & Materials for Energy (ICGM/AIME, UMR CNRS 5253). He was Full Professor @ the University of Montpellier and Head of Laboratory of Polymer Science and Advanced Organic Materials - LEMP/MAO. Dr es Sciences from Institute Charles Sadron (former Centre de Recherches sur les Macromolécules), University Louis Pasteur Strasbourg. His present activities concern High performance composites and nanocomposites, UV & EB coatings, Biomaterials, Green Chemistry and Aircrafts manufacturing. He has published 14 books and 12 patents. He has advised nearly 95 M.S. and 52 Ph.D. students with whom he has published over 430 per reviewed papers. More than 45 years experience in Polymer Science with 10 years in the industry (IBM USA, MOD UK, SNPA/Total France). Currently ERA CHAIR holder Horizon 2020.

Dr. Alexandru Rotaru
Centre of Advanced Research in Bionanoconjugates and Biopolymers department, "Petru Poni" Institute of Macromolecular Chemistry. He received his PhD (Organic Chemistry) in 2005 at the "Al. I. Cuza" University of Iasi, Romania. He is senior researcher at "Petru Poni" Institute of Macromolecular Chemistry, Iasi, Romania since 2012. During his PhD studies Alexandru Rotaru spent twelve moths DAAD scholarship at the Department of Organic Chemistry, Heidelberg University, Germany. After the completion of his PhD studies he continued with postdoctoral position at Inorganic Chemistry Department, Heidelberg University, Germany (24 months), followed by another postdoctoral position at Aarhus University, Denmark (4 years). Scientific fields of interest include: organic synthesis, oligonucleotide chemistry, preparation and characterization of DNA-based nanostructures, supramolecular chemistry, metal nanoparticles and nanoconjugates of metal nanoparticles with carbon nanotubes. Alexandru Rotaru is author and co-author of 37 publications and multiple participations at national and international conferences. He was project member and director in European and national projects, and he currently is member of the Romanian Chemical Society.
